About Terminal C
Terminal C is one of five terminals at Dallas Fort Worth International Airport (DFW), located in the central area of the airport complex between Dallas and Fort Worth, Texas. The terminal serves as a major hub for American Airlines and handles both domestic and international flights.
Opened in 1974 as part of DFW's original terminal complex, Terminal C underwent significant renovations and expansions in the 2000s and 2010s. The terminal features 28 gates numbered C1 through C39, with some gate numbers omitted. The facility spans approximately 1.2 million square feet and is connected to the airport's automated Skylink train system, which provides transportation between all terminals.
Terminal C houses American Airlines' flagship Admirals Club lounges, including the premium Flagship Lounge for first-class and business-class passengers on international and transcontinental flights. The terminal also features the American Airlines Customer Service Center and various dining and retail establishments.
The terminal's design incorporates large windows and high ceilings, characteristic of DFW's architectural style. Security checkpoints are located on the upper level, with the main checkpoint serving gates C1-C18 and a smaller checkpoint for gates C20-C39. Ground transportation options include rental cars, taxis, ride-sharing services, and the Trinity Metro TEXRail connection to downtown Fort Worth.
Terminal C primarily serves American Airlines mainline flights and American Eagle regional services, with destinations including major U.S. cities and select international routes to Mexico, Central America, and the Caribbean.
